
NewAKString is effectively the default for any new IDL interface, so let's mark this as the default behavior. It also makes it much easier to figure out whatever interfaces are still left to port over to new AK String.
24 lines
889 B
Text
24 lines
889 B
Text
#import <DOM/HTMLCollection.idl>
|
|
#import <HTML/HTMLElement.idl>
|
|
#import <HTML/HTMLTableCellElement.idl>
|
|
|
|
// https://html.spec.whatwg.org/multipage/tables.html#htmltablerowelement
|
|
[Exposed=Window, UseDeprecatedAKString]
|
|
interface HTMLTableRowElement : HTMLElement {
|
|
|
|
[HTMLConstructor] constructor();
|
|
|
|
[CEReactions, Reflect] attribute DOMString align;
|
|
[CEReactions, Reflect=char] attribute DOMString ch;
|
|
[CEReactions, Reflect=charoff] attribute DOMString chOff;
|
|
[CEReactions, Reflect=valign] attribute DOMString vAlign;
|
|
|
|
[CEReactions, LegacyNullToEmptyString, Reflect=bgcolor] attribute DOMString bgColor;
|
|
|
|
readonly attribute long rowIndex;
|
|
readonly attribute long sectionRowIndex;
|
|
|
|
[SameObject] readonly attribute HTMLCollection cells;
|
|
HTMLTableCellElement insertCell(optional long index = -1);
|
|
[CEReactions] undefined deleteCell(long index);
|
|
};
|